For further information please contact your | | local IBM representative. | +---------------------------------------------------------------+ ================================================================= ZG89-0141 IBM 7561 Industrial Computer Model 011 IBM 7561 Industrial Computer Model 111 IBM 7562 Industrial Computer Model 011 IBM 7562 Industrial Computer Model 111 The 7561/7562 Industrial Computers are designed for industrial plant floor environments where a system which can function in harsh physical conditionsis required. The system is highlighted by Micro Channel (TM) architecture with a 20 MHz 80386 32-bit microprocessor with a capability of supporting up to 16 MB of memory (8 MB on the planar), 60 MB of disk storage, a 1.44 diskette drive and VGA graphics. The 7561/7562 Model's 011 will have 1 or 2 (1.44 MB) Diskette drives. The 7561/7562 Model's 111 will also have a 60 MB hard file. The 7561 and the 7562 are identical in function and feature capacity however they differ in form. The 7561 is a bench top system and the 7562 is designed to be installed in an industrial 19 inch rack. Expansion Card Populate the Expansion Card (FC 0605 P/N 6450605) 2-8MB 80386 memory Expansion Option with: o (FC 0603 P/N 6450603) 1MB Memory Module Kit and/or o (FC 0604 P/N 6450604) 2MB Memory Module Kit Previously announced 80386 processor feature: 80387 Math Co-Processor The 80387 Math Co-Processor provides additional processing power and performance for application programs requiring many or repetitive arithmetic calculations. The 80386/80387 conforms to the ANSI/IEEE floating-point standard and runs most applications written for the 80286/80287 and 8086/8087 based systems, unmodified. This option is installed in the Math Co-Processor socket on the system board and does not require an expansion slot. Previously announced microchannel adapters/adapter features/cables by order of feature number: PC Network Broadband Cables The following cables are orderable for the IBM PC Network broadband: Base Expander Cabler (#0230) Short Distance Kit (#0231) Medium Distance Kit (#0232) Long Distance Kit (#0233) Cabling segments: 25 foot (#0234) 50 foot (#0235) 100 foot (#0236) 200 foot (#0237) Dual Asynchronous Adapter/A This feature provides asynchronous communications on two independent RS232C ports. The feature is programmable and supports communications speeds from 50 to 19,200 bps. This adapter supports signal transmission across 50 feet of cable. A maximum of three Dual Async Adapters can be physically attached providing a total of seven serial ports (one on the system board plus two per adapter). Total system load will limit the practical number of ports and the speed of each port. This adapter requires one expansion slot. PC Network Baseband Adapter/A The PC Network Baseband Adapter/A is a feature card that includes a modular baseband modem for connecting to a PC Network baseband network. The adapter features a 2 megabit per second transmission speed with a CSMA/CD access protocol and supports the Token-Ring 802.2/LLC protocols via the IBM Local Area Network Support Program. This adapter requires one expansion slot. Token Ring Network Adapter/A The IBM Token-Ring Network Adapter/A transmits and receives at a speed of 4 million bits per second using protocols conforming to IEEE 802.5 and ECMA 89 standards. The adapter provides logical link control functions conforming with th IEEE 802.2 standard. The adapter The adapter provides 16KB of random access memory (RAM) and provides all of the function of the IBM Token-Ring Network PC Adapter (#3391) and the IBM Token-Ring Network PC Adapter II (#5063). A diskette is included with the adapter that contains an adapter diagnostic program and a single-ring network diagnostic program. The adapter diagnostic program is used to verify the correct operation of the adapter. The ring diagnostic program is used as an aid in network problem determination. Permanent and recoverable error conditions are detected, and information on the probable source of the error is presented. IBM Data Migration Facility This connecting tool provides an easy method for customer file transfers from an installed industrial computer with a 5.25-inch diskette drive to the 7561 and 7562 Industrial computers. It operates via the printer cable on the existing system and the parallel port on the new system. The product packaging contains a 5.25-inch diskette with a send program, the connector itself, and the appropriate instructions for use. A receive program, also required, has been included on the 3.5-inch starter diskette packaged with each Industrial Computer. DOS is required for both @ the sending and receiving systems. Level 2.0 or higher is required on the sending system, and 3.30 for reception. DESCRIPTION The newly announced models of the IBM 7561 and 7562 Industrial Computers provide increased performance for industrial applications, including IBM network functions and workstation emulation capabilities. The new systems use the Personal System/2 advanced Micro Channel (TM) architecture to integrate the industrial requirements with many of the existing Personal System/2 features. The system is based on the 80386 microprocessor running at 20 MHz and supports an optional 80387 math co-processor. Performance is further enhanced through the use of a 32-bit wide data path to system memory. The high level of feature integration on the system board reduces the requirement for optional adapters. These include; enhanced VGA graphics subsystem, EIA serial communications controller, audio subsystem, parallel printer port interface, keyboard port, mouse port, real time clock with battery-back-up, diskette drive controller, socket for an optional 20 MHz 80387 math co-processor, two 16-bit Micro Channel (TM) expansion slots and two standard 32-bit Micro Channel (TM) expansion slots. All models include 2 MB of standard memory and a 1.44 MB high density 3.5-inch diskette drive. The model 111 includes a 60 MB fixed disk drive. SECURITY, AUDITABILITY AND CONTROL Security and auditability features of this product are: The IBM 7562 includes a diskette - area access door with a security keylock, which, when locked prevents the insertion or removal of diskettes. This product utilizes the security and auditability features of the software and/or application software. Additional security is provided with a keylock on the rear of the system unit to secure the covers to the chassis. Password security is implemented for both a power-on password and a keyboard disable password.
